A precedent, not a proposal

Bihar remembers how to lead

The defining questions of the superintelligence era — how do we know a machine's decision is valid? who governs intelligent systems? who teaches a civilisation its next body of knowledge? — are questions this soil has answered before, at world scale.

Yājñavalkya & Gārgī

the dialogue format itself, born in open assembly at Janaka's court

Vaishali's republics

deliberative governance centuries before most of the world

The councils

Rajgir, Vaishali, Pataliputra — the world's earliest knowledge-validation assemblies

Āryabhaṭa

the mathematics of place value that runs inside every computer on earth

Nalanda

the world's distribution network for knowledge itself

Navya-Nyāya

Mithila's formal systems for validating knowledge-claims

The sitting, orchestrated live

An operations room run with Gārgī

On the day, the convening itself is a working control room: arrivals confirmed by QR at the doors, the Frontier Rounds rotating on an agent-built schedule, questions for the Convenor clustered as they arrive, and the Opportunity Map released to every phone at the close of the stage programme.

Gārgī attends to each guest individually — schedule, rotation, introductions — under the supervision of the Convenor's office.

Two rings, by invitation

Attendance

The Dialogues is invitation-only, in two rings: an Inner Ring of eighty curated participants, and an Assembly of one hundred and seventy nominated through partner institutions. There is no open registration.
